Former Manchester City goalkeeper Alex Williams is a friend of the stars and a man of the people. Pals include Noel and Liam Gallagher, both star-struck teenagers in the early 1980s when Alex was their hero and kept goal at Maine Road.
Alex tells how he has crossed paths with the brothers on many occasions while leading the club’s trail-blazing community scheme, inspiring back street kids like him to turn their lives around. Alex also endured horrific racism as the first modern-day black goalkeeper in England.
He courageously reached the top before an injury he kept secret from team-mates ended his playing career in 1987 at the age of 25. His amusing, entertaining and revealing stories are contained in his autobiography You Saw Me Standing Alone.
